  • Facet 1: The role of social media
    Social media platforms are a major source of misinformation. False information can spread quickly and easily on these platforms, as people are more likely to share information that confirms their existing beliefs.
  • Facet 2: The role of confirmation bias
    Confirmation bias is the tendency to seek out information that confirms our existing beliefs. This can lead us to be more likely to believe false information that supports our views.
  • Facet 3: The role of emotional appeals
    False information is often spread using emotional appeals, such as fear or anger. This can make it more difficult to think critically about the information and to identify it as false.
  • Facet 4: The role of bots and trolls
    Bots and trolls are automated accounts that are used to spread false information online. These accounts can be used to create the illusion of support for a particular, or to spread misinformation about a particular topic.

One example of a fact-checking website is Snopes. Snopes is a website that debunks urban legends, hoaxes, and other forms of false information. Snopes has a team of researchers who investigate claims and determine whether they are true or false. Snopes has been debunking false information for over 30 years, and it is a valuable resource for anyone who wants to verify the accuracy of information that they find online.

Another example of a fact-checking tool is Google Fact Check. Google Fact Check is a tool that allows you to search for information about a particular claim. Google Fact Check will then show you a list of articles and other sources that have fact-checked the claim. This can help you to determine whether the claim is true or false.

  • Facet 2: Phishing

    Phishing is a type of online fraud that attempts to trick people into giving up their personal information, such as passwords or credit card numbers. Phishing attacks often take the form of emails or text messages that appear to be from legitimate organizations, such as banks or government agencies.

  • Facet 3: Malware

    Malware is a type of software that is designed to damage or disable a computer system. Malware can be spread through a variety of means, such as email attachments, malicious websites, or USB drives. Once installed on a computer, malware can steal personal information, encrypt files, or even take control of the computer.

  • Facet 4: Cyberbullying

    Cyberbullying is the use of electronic devices to bully or harass someone. Cyberbullying can take many forms, such as sending hurtful or threatening messages, posting embarrassing photos or videos, or spreading rumors online.
